Analysis

In 2023, agricultural land in OECD (FAO) stood at 1.17 billion.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.3% on the previous year and down 1.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, agricultural land in OECD (FAO) peaked at 1.38 billion in 1968 and was at its lowest, 1.16 billion, in 2016.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 63 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 1.36 billion 1.35 billion 1.38 billion 9
1970s 1.35 billion 1.34 billion 1.36 billion 10
1980s 1.33 billion 1.32 billion 1.34 billion 10
1990s 1.31 billion 1.29 billion 1.32 billion 10
2000s 1.25 billion 1.21 billion 1.29 billion 10
2010s 1.18 billion 1.16 billion 1.21 billion 10
2020s 1.17 billion 1.16 billion 1.17 billion 4
